  10. P

    FORGE MOTORSPORT BOV not working

    Start the car and let it idle, then go look at the valve, you should see the main aluminum piston lifted, pinch the vacuum line (or remove it and quickly cap it with your finger). The piston should drop back down and lift again when you reinstall the vac line.

  12. P

    Bov Help

    You can't use the FMDVMAZ3 as a vent to atmosphere valve. It is a single piston unit and will be open pretty much whenever the manifold is in vacuum and this will cause a huge leak. We make a separate vent to atmosphere valve the FMDVMAZ301 that has a secondary piston that stays closed to...
